Transaction ecdb77d4fe16876bd511fb5335497b716a1acbbfe5c7a33a77efd95283dffa7f

1 Input
2 Outputs
  • ecdb77d4fe16876bd511fb5335497b716a1acbbfe5c7a33a77efd95283dffa7f:0
  • value  152787
    address  151nRa9C8WxNHWcezxjKU6NkBAAUniTS5j
  • ecdb77d4fe16876bd511fb5335497b716a1acbbfe5c7a33a77efd95283dffa7f:1
  • value  183629
    address  1MgZRkm66Eho5M9gcuHChcNPCTBocJET6s